Microsoft Founding and Early Equity
Paul Allen cofounded Microsoft in 1975 alongside Bill Gates. His early stake in the company formed the backbone of what would become a massive fortune as software shaped the personal computing era.
Investment Portfolio and Diversification
Beyond Microsoft, Paul Allen built a broad investment portfolio spanning venture capital, private equity, and real estate. This diversification helped protect and grow his wealth over decades.
Sports Teams and Media Ventures
Allen owned several professional sports franchises and media assets, including the Portland Trail Blazers and Seattle Seahawks. These holdings added significant value to his overall net worth and increased his public profile.
Real Estate and Aerospace Projects
Through Vulcan Inc, Paul Allen invested in large scale real estate developments and ambitious aerospace initiatives such as space tourism. These high risk, high reward projects expanded his legacy beyond technology.
